With wifi calling, your phone connects to ATT's Mobile network through wifi instead of through a cell tower. This allows your phone to call and text even when not close to a cell tower and where normally you would get little or no signal. Wi-Fi Calling. Use your Wi-Fi connection to talk and text when cellular coverage is limited or unavailable. Wi-Fi Calling is turned on as part of the activation process. To use Wi-Fi Calling, you'll need a Wi-Fi Internet connection and a postpaid AT&T wireless account provisioned with HD Voice. Activate Wi-Fi calling. 1.
